Research and Teaching:

Dr. Agon Hamza's research is on German idealism, political thinking and philosophy, religion and film theory. He is currently working on a book on Hegel's political philosophy.  He is the founder and co-editor-in-chief, with Frank Ruda, of the international journal of political thought and philosophy, Crisis and Critique, as well as the co-host of the Crisis and Critique Podcast: Philosophy and Its Other Scene. His recent publications include Reading Freud with Slavoj Zizek and Frank Ruda (Polity: forthcoming); Reading Hegel with Slavoj Zizek and Frank Ruda (Polity, 2022); Reading Marx with Slavoj Zizek and Frank Ruda (Polity, 2018); and Althusser and Pasolini: Philosophy, Marxism, and Film (Palgrave, 2016).  He is also editor of Althusser and Theology: Religion, Politics and Philosophy (Brill, 2016).  At JMU, Dr. Hamza teaches an upper-level course in political philosophy, Philosophy 335: The Individual, the State, and Justice.
